The Houston Auto Show is an annual, 5 day long auto show that takes place in January at NRG Park.
Each year, over 500 of the newest model year import and domestic vehicles, alternative fuel/electric vehicles and concept cars from 40+ manufacturers debut at the show.
As of 2018, the Houston Auto Show is Held at the NRG Center, with over 40 manufacturers, on a footprint of over 800,000 sq ft.
The 2021 show was officially postponed from the expected January dates due to concerns with public safety during a pandemic.
World debuts for the Houston Auto Show include The 2013 Jeep Grand Cherokee in 2012, and the 2007 Ford Expedition in 2006.
